Senior Manager Accounting & Controllership

Job Description

We’re looking for the right person to join our Finance team based in Luxembourg, someone who’s ready to help us deliver on our commitments today and develop global processes to sustain flexibility as the business needs change. This is an excellent opportunity for a highly motivated individual to support the Global Corporate Controller Organization.

 

Essential Responsibilities

·         Support statutory financial statements and regulatory filings including supporting the design/implementation of global audit process for a global ERP system.

·         Support Discounted Cash Flow Models for Otis foreign subsidiaries on an annual basis.

·         Assist in the overall management and governance of the Otis Holding Companies including budgeting, financial reviews, coordination of meetings and key documents.

·         Provides overall support to the directors of over 20 holding companies.

·         Perform ad-hoc requests and special projects.

·         New roles and responsibilities as we continue to define and standardize processes across the Controller’s organization, including strategic initiatives and regulatory requirements.

Education / Certifications

·         B.S. in Accounting

·         CPA (or equivalent) and MBA a plus

Basic Qualifications

·         5 to 10 years of related accounting/financial reporting general finance experience required.

·         Experience with finance ERP environments, JDE a plus

·         Strong project management skills

·         Excellent communications skills, must be fluent in English

·         Candidate should possess strong communication skills with the demonstrated ability to interact with all levels of Controller's Dept. and other staff and management across jurisdictions and global finance functions

·         Ability to balance multiple tasks and work both autonomously and in a group

Otis is the world’s leading elevator and escalator manufacturing, installation, and service company. We move 2.4 billion people every day and maintain approximately 2.4 million customer units worldwide, the industry's largest Service portfolio.  

You may recognize our products in some of the world’s most famous landmarks including the Eiffel Tower, Empire State Building, Burj Khalifa and the Petronas Twin Towers! We are 72,000 people strong, including engineers, digital technology experts, sales, and functional specialists, as well as factory and field technicians, all committed to meeting the diverse needs of our customers and passengers in more than 200 countries and territories worldwide.
